Believe it or not squirrels does have the love for nuts. Over 20 years of research scientists at University of Alberta have concluded that red squirrels are able to predict when there will be plentiful of nuts on the trees they feast on. To take advantage of the harvest season about to occur, they remarkably produce more babies to give them a hand.
So when all the nuts in the world are gone into the finest chocolates…they decided to commit suicide!
